There's a quantum leap from all other local callings to bishop.
Bishops are approved by Salt Lake, and are considered elite.
Only bishops are supposed to hear sensitive confessions in a ward.
The ones I worked with fully believed they had the "spirit of discernment", which is that they interpret their own hunches as promptings from the holy ghost. In some cases this leads to gross injustices and injuries.
